Operational workflow

From capture to archived PDF-ready report in four controlled steps — ideal for capstone demonstrations and pilot clinics.

1

Secure intake

JPEG/PNG uploads with size and integrity checks; preview before submission reduces bad captures.

2

Automated preprocessing

Images are standardized to model input tensors with consistent scaling for reproducible scores.

3

Evidence bundle

Each prediction stores disease label, softmax confidence, timestamp, and links to education content.

4

Reporting

Print-optimized HTML reports support browser PDF export for charts and EMR attachment workflows.

Designed for responsible deployment

This platform is intended for educational and decision-support contexts. Always validate model performance on your target population and follow local regulatory requirements for medical devices. Administrators can rotate model weights, remap class order, and purge obsolete records without touching unrelated tenants.

Dataset alignment

Train with curated public corpora such as the Skin Diseases image dataset on Kaggle, then upload your .keras/.h5 artifact and label map.
